[QUOTE="Arcturus, post: 1089190, member: 85747"] That both Exeter and Saracens have continuity in management, deep and highly successful academy systems, and have been the most successful sides domestically and in Europe over the past decade probably isn't a coincidence. It is all very well reducing the cap to help make the game more sustainable, but it is patently peculiar that there isn't a review in to how clubs are adequately rewarded for taking the risk to develop talent and reform the remuneration structure to clubs for players that are called up for international duty.
